Cloud Service >> Knowledgebase >> Cloud Server >> What Is CSS and How Does It Work?
submit query

Cut Hosting Costs! Submit Query Today!

What Is CSS and How Does It Work?

Introduction

Cascading Style Sheets (CSS) is a vital technology that controls the appearance and layout of web pages. It works alongside HTML and JavaScript to enhance user experience by defining colors, fonts, spacing, and overall design. Without CSS, websites would appear as plain text, making them visually unappealing and hard to navigate. According to statistics, over 95% of modern websites use CSS to improve design and responsiveness.

CSS is essential in web development as it helps create mobile-friendly and fast-loading websites. With the rise of dynamic web applications, CSS plays a crucial role in ensuring seamless user interaction. It allows developers to manage design elements efficiently, reducing the need for repetitive coding. A well-structured CSS file improves website performance and accessibility.

In this article, we will explore CSS, its working mechanism, types, and key components. Additionally, we will discuss how CSS enhances web performance and why it is crucial for businesses using a dedicated server or a Windows dedicated server in India. We will also touch upon the best practices for using CSS efficiently on the best Windows dedicated server setups.

What Is CSS?

CSS (Cascading Style Sheets) is a stylesheet language that defines the presentation of web pages. It allows developers to separate content from design, making web development more manageable. CSS controls elements such as layout, colors, fonts, and animations, ensuring a consistent look across different devices and screen sizes.

How Does CSS Work?

CSS works by applying style rules to HTML elements. These rules can be added in three ways:

1. Inline CSS

This method applies styles directly within an HTML element using the style attribute. Example:

This is a styled paragraph.

2. Internal CSS

Defined within the

3. External CSS

This is the most efficient method, linking an external stylesheet to an HTML file.

Key Components of CSS

1. Selectors

Selectors target HTML elements to apply styles. Common types include:

Class Selector (.classname): Targets elements with a specific class.

ID Selector (#idname): Targets a unique element.

Element Selector (h1, p): Targets all specified elements.

2. Properties and Values

CSS properties define how elements appear, while values specify the details. Example:

h1 { color: red; font-size: 24px; }

3. Box Model

CSS structures web elements using the box model, which consists of:

Margin: Space outside the element.

Border: Outline around the element.

Padding: Space between content and border.

Content: The actual text or image inside the element.

Why CSS Matters for a Windows Dedicated Server?

For businesses using a Windows dedicated server in India, CSS helps optimize website speed and efficiency. A well-structured CSS file ensures faster page loading times, which is crucial for user retention and SEO rankings. The best Windows dedicated server offers advanced caching and storage features that work seamlessly with CSS-based websites to enhance performance.

Types of CSS Styling

1. Static CSS

This is the most common type, where styles are predefined and do not change dynamically.

2. Dynamic CSS

This type includes CSS frameworks like SASS and LESS, allowing customization based on user interactions.

Best Practices for Using CSS

1. Use External Stylesheets

External stylesheets enhance performance by keeping HTML clean and structured.

2. Optimize CSS for Fast Loading

Minimizing CSS files and using efficient selectors improve loading speed, especially on a dedicated server.

3. Implement Responsive Design

Using media queries ensures websites look good on all devices, from desktops to mobile phones.

4. Avoid Excessive Use of !important

Overusing !important can make CSS difficult to maintain and debug.

Conclusion

CSS is a powerful tool that enhances the design and usability of websites. Whether using a simple blog or running an advanced business site on a Windows dedicated server in India, CSS plays a crucial role in ensuring a seamless user experience. By following best practices and optimizing CSS for performance, businesses can improve website speed, accessibility, and overall functionality. Investing in the best Windows dedicated server further enhances CSS efficiency, making websites more responsive and visually appealing.

Cut Hosting Costs! Submit Query Today!

Grow With Us

Let’s talk about the future, and make it happen!